Snickerdoodle Crescent Rolls

- 1 tube crescent rolls
- 4 teaspoons peanut butter crunchy or creamy
- 2 tbsp sugar
- 1 tsp ground cinnamon

Line a baking sheet with a silicone baking mat or parchment paper.
In a small bowl combine the cinnamon and sugar.
Unroll the crescent dough and carefully separate into individual triangles along the perforated lines.
Spread 1/2 teaspoon of peanut butter onto the top side of the crescents, starting at the wide end and leaving a little space along the edges.
Sprinkle each with a pinch of cinnamon sugar. Roll into crescents.
Bake at 350 degrees for 8 minutes, until golden brown. While still hot carefully roll them in the cinnamon and sugar. Roll again after they’ve cooled.
These can be stored in an airtight container for up to 3 days.
Can also be frozen for up to one month.
